Hello !, thank you very much for visiting the post, thanks for your words.ian1954 wrote:I enjoyed both videos.
I like the use of translucent covering on the wings - especially when it shows off an excellent build.
Which covering material did you use?
Excuse not speak English, I helped me with the google translator to express myself. By this I will tell, if something does not understand, please ask again.
To use SUPER MONOKOTE wings transparent blue.
The fuselage is painted, seven hands of DOPE sanding between coats, after this di printing, accusing if the surface has some detail and sanded again after this, paint with an airbrush with polyurethane varnish yellow, leaving acceptable termination.
I repeat, if something does not understand, please ask again.
Thanks greetings, Mauricio.
